FM receives credentials of new Australian ambassador
[07/08/2018 06:26]

RIYADH-SABA
Foreign Minister Khalid Alyemany received a copy of the credentials of the new Australian ambassador to Yemen, Radwan Jawdat.

In a meeting they held in Riyadh on Tuesday, Alyemanypraised the distinguished relations between Yemen and Australia, citing the humanitarian aid contributions of Australia to our country.

He expressed the government's readiness to cooperate with the Australian ambassador and provide the necessary support to enable him to carry out his mission in strengthening the Yemeni-Australian friendship relations.

He stressed the Yemeni government's commitment to peace, and in this regard supporting the efforts of the United Nations peace mediator Martin Griffiths' efforts as he seeks to broker a deal between the government and the Houthi rebels.

He pointed out that the main problem preventing the the achievement of peace in Yemen is the Houthi stubborn rejection of all peace initiatives and sticking to the choice of war. He pointed to Iran's irresponsible and destabilizing practices in the region;supporting terrorist groups including the Houthi militia in Yemen.
